Re: PostgreSQL et tuning ...

From: Hervé Piedvache <herve(at)elma(dot)fr>
To: LELARGE Guillaume <gleu(at)wanadoo(dot)fr>, Francois Suter <dba(at)paragraf(dot)ch>
Cc: pgsql-fr-generale(at)postgresql(dot)org
Subject: Re: PostgreSQL et tuning ...
Date: 2004-02-27 11:08:29
Message-ID: 200402271208.29423.herve@elma.fr
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-fr-generale

Bonjour,

Navré pour mon long temps de réponse, mais je suis souvent en déplacement en
ce moment ... bref ...

Le Lundi 23 Février 2004 21:17, LELARGE Guillaume a écrit :
>
> Francois Suter a écrit :
> >> [1] http://sqlpro.developpez.com/OptimSQL/SQL_optim.html
> >
> > Personnellement, je n'ai pas de projet suffisamment gros pour demander
> > un tuning particulièrement fin de PostgreSQL. Je me suis contenté
> > jusqu'à maintenant d'optimiser mes requêts SQL et ça a suffi.
>
> J'ai réalisé pas mal de tests ces deniers temps sur le tuning du serveur
> postgresql que j'administre. Et ça donne généralement de bons résultats.
>
> > Mais le fil de discussion est intéressant. Je voulais juste mentionner
> > la page suivante:
> >
> > http://www.varlena.com/varlena/GeneralBits/Tidbits/perf.html
> >
> > pour les ceusses qui ne la connaîtrait pas, mais elle est en anglais.
>
> Il existe aussi le document de Jean-Paul, écrit aussi en anglais :
> http://www.argudo.org/postgresql/soft-tuning.php

Loin de moi l'idée de dire que le document de Jean-Paul n'est pas suffisant,
car il évoque des points très importants et ouvre assurément les yeux de
nombreux débutants, et autres utilisateurs (ne soyons pas réducteur) qui ne
sauraient pas ce genre de chose, typiquement la règle des 80/20, ou
l'utilisation de l'explain et des vacuum sont des points que l'on invente pas
et qu'il faut expérimenter pour maitriser un jour PostgreSQL ...

Maintenant Jean-Paul ne rentre pas dans le détail des options (paramètrages)
nécessaires au fonctionnement de PostgreSQL. C'est surtout de ça dont
j'aimerai que l'on puisse parler ... il est vrai que nous ne manipulons pas
tous des bases gigantesques avec PostgreSQL ... mais justement les nouvelles
opportunités de l'Open Source nous amènent en entreprise à nous retrouver
aujourd'hui face à des problématiques fonctionnelles qui ne pourront
qu'améliorer ces produits, mais qui à ce jour nous posent de nouvelles
questions ...
Typiquement aujourd'hui des clients potentiels nous demande des configurations
de base de données pour traiter des volumes de plusieurs Tera-octets ...
Est-ce bien raisonnable sous PotsgreSQL ?
Quelle solution de backup à chaud ?
Comment gérer les vacuum avec 2 milliard d'enregistrements dans une table ?
Quelle configuration pour gérer un service web avec 40 millions de pages vue
qui toutes vont faire une requête SQL ? Quelle configuration matériel ?
Quid de la réplication ??

De vastes questions ... mais je pense qu'il nous faut en trouver les réponses
en commun et essayer de parler de solutions dans des cadres professionnels
qui vont mettre en avant PostgreSQL et donner de vraies preuves que les
produits commerciaux peuvent être largués par des produits Open Source, mais
aussi avoir l'honnêté de donner les limites de l'Open Source.

Cordialement,
--
Hervé Piedvache

Elma Ingénierie Informatique
6 rue du Faubourg Saint-Honoré
F-75008 - Paris - France
Pho. 33-144949901
Fax. 33-144949902

In response to

Browse pgsql-fr-generale by date

  From Date Subject
Next Message Hervé Piedvache 2004-02-27 11:14:55 Re: Des nouvelles...
Previous Message Francois Suter 2004-02-27 09:50:57 Re: Des nouvelles...